### Wiki Roles — Note for Code Reviewers (Pinewharf Docs)

As a reviewer on Pinewharf, you'll hold the Curator role in our internal wiki: you can approve page edits and merge documentation changes, but not alter role assignments themselves. If your Curator session is ever revoked mid-review, use the self-service recovery flow. It asks for the team recovery passphrase, which appears directly below.

recovery phrase for fawif-tajeg: norael-aldmir-casir-brivan-ulaion

Subject: Partner SFTP drop — new owner

Hi,

As you review the pending changes to the Harborline ingest scripts, note that ownership of the partner SFTP drop is changing at the end of the month. This includes key rotation, the nightly pull job, and the quarantine folder for malformed files. Review comments on the retry logic should still go through the normal PR flow, but questions about drop-folder conventions or partner onboarding now go to the new owner. The incoming owner is listed below.

signatory, tagaf-bahaf: Praael Fenmir Rusok

# BranchReaper — stale-branch cleanup bot (env file header)
# Read this before editing anything below. The bot scans all
# repos in the Lintvale org nightly and deletes branches with no
# commits in 90 days. Protected-branch patterns are honored, but
# a typo here WILL delete work, so double-check your globs.
# Dry-run defaults to on; only disable it after a reviewed change.
# Grace-period and notification settings follow the standard
# format. The bot's repo-write credential is set on the very next line.

vault entry, yahif-yajep: COURIER_KEY29=b802bdf8034096b65a51c6ba5abe2

Security reviewers should note: any change to the scrubbing rules, retention window, or symbol-server access requires documented approval, because raw traces may contain user-entered text. Pipeline code changes ship through the standard review path, but configuration overrides in production are approval-gated separately and logged. Emergency bypasses expire after four hours and must be ratified retroactively. Approval authority rests with the person named below.

named custodian: Brivan Eliath Quenox Frador